A television. So named because its function is to deliver crap into your living room.
"Put the shit pump on, love. It's time for "Celebrity Big Brother" again."
by Zog The Undeniable August 13, 2011
Get the shit pump mug.
A general term defining people who seem to be well taken care of but are totally useless.
"Did you see the new guy they just brought in? What a shit pump!"
by Johnny Esquire April 29, 2006
Get the shit pump mug.